Here's a tip for the GuitarTricks "looper" tool that you may or may not know.

When trying to separate a lick from a video, hit the "Loop On" button at the right end of the red toolbar under the vid.

Now click the video back on the running time bar to before the lick you want to isolate.

Run the vid.[br]When the vid gets just to the start of the lick, hit your "a" key on your keyboard.[br]This will place the looper at the start of the lick.[br]When the vid gets to the end of the lick, hit your "b" key.[br]The looper is now at the end of the lick.[br]Move the vid back to just before the A pointer and let the vid run.[br]It will now just run between the A & B pointers.

I found the instructions for the Looper somewhere on GT's site but I'll be darned if I can find them again. I did write them out when I originally found them -

Keyboard Shortcuts

a - looper tag to start of required section.

b - tag to end of required section.

Left cursor - skip back 10 seconds.

Right cursor - skip forward 10 seconds.

r - toggle the looping (on - off, on - off)

x - re-set looper start & end points.

Originally Posted by: jensenchris11

I'm using GT on an iPad via Safari and can't see any buttons to operate the looper. I can use the looper if I access GT via the app. Is it only able to be used via the GT app?

You might need to set the browser to load GT in desktop mode. Click the AA icon on the left side of the browser address bar and it will display a drop down menu with an option to request desktop website.
